TJ Turner, tenor

Dr. T. J. Turner, tenor, was recently named one of Memphis’s Top 20 Under 35 and received the University of Memphis Graduate Document Award for his dissertation research. He has received positive reviews of his “solid performances” in his professional debut as The Doctor in The Handmaid’s Tale with GLOW Lyric Theatre: Opera Wire described his “crystalline high tenor” as “delightful to listen to.”

He also performed in Kristin Chenoweth’s My Love Letter to Broadway; other notable roles include Edna Turnblad in Hairspray, William Barfée in The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ee, and the title roles in Mozart’s La clemenza di Tito and Bizet’s Le docteur miracle.

Dr. Turner holds degrees from the University of Memphis, the University of South Carolina, and Furman University. He is currently Instructor of Voice at the Lawson Academy of the Arts at Converse University and continues to perform extensively throughout the southeast.
